You must not remove this notice, or any other, from this +;; software. +;; +;; clojure.contrib.lib (Lib) +;; +;; Lib provides functions for loading and managing Clojure source code +;; contained in Java resources. +;; +;; A 'lib' is a unit of Clojure source code contained in a Java resource +;; and named by a symbol. The lib's name is used to identify the lib and +;; to locate the resource that contains it. +;; +;; Lib provides functions to: +;; +;; - find a resource given a classpath-relative path +;; - load code from a resource given an absolute path +;; - load libs from resources given lib names +;; - load namespace definitions given namespace specs +;; - ensure namespace definitions have been loaded while avoiding +;; duplicate loads, and +;; - create a namespace and refer 'clojure into it succinctly +;; +;; Symbols, Namespaces, Packages +;; +;; Symbols in Clojure are two-part identifiers - with an optional +;; namespace and a name, both strings. Namespaces are used to distinguish +;; two symbols that have the same name. Vars are named by symbols that +;; must have a namespace part, and thus can be considered to be in +;; namespaces. [From Clojure documentation] +;; +;; Packages in Java play a role similar to Clojure namespaces - they +;; partition the global namespace to allow large programs to avoid name +;; conflicts. Java defines a mapping from package names to directories +;; within classpath: components of a package name separated by periods +;; correspond to components of a classpath-relative path separated by +;; slashes. Lib uses this same mapping to locate libs and namespaces in +;; classpath. +;; +;; Loading Libs +;; +;; A lib's name provides the location of the resource that contains it in +;; classpath. The resource name is the last component of the lib's path +;; followed by ".clj". For example, a lib named 'a.b.c is contained in the +;; resource "<classpath>/a/b/c.clj". +;; +;; Loading Namespaces +;; +;; To load a namespace definition, Lib loads the 'root lib' for the +;; namespace. The root lib's name is derived from the namespace name by +;; repeating its last component. For example, the root lib for the +;; namespace 'x.y.z is the lib 'x.y.z.z contained in the resource +;; "<classpath>/x/y/z/z.clj". The namespace definition may be entirely +;; within the root lib or it may span multiple libs in the hierarchy of +;; directories at and under the namespace's directory. In the latter case +;; the root lib must include commands to (directly or indirectly) load the +;; remaining libs. +;; +;; Nsspecs +;; +;; An nsspec specifies a namespace to load. It is either a namespace name +;; or a list containing the namespace name and zero or more options +;; expressed as squential keywords and values. Nsspec examples: +;; - 'clojure.contrib.sql +;; - '(clojure.contrib.sql) +;; - '(clojure.contrib.sql :exclude (get-connection)). +;; - '(clojure.contrib.sql :as sql) +;; +;; Prefix Lists +;; +;; It is common for Clojure code to depend on several libs or namespaces +;; whose names have one or more initial components in common. When +;; specifying lib or namespace names for Lib to use, prefix lists can be +;; used to reduce repetition in the call. A prefix list is a list +;; containing the shared prefix followed by lib or namespace names and/or +;; prefix lists with the shared prefix elided.
